Baked Italian Grinder Sandwiches: The Ultimate Crispy, Melty Recipe

These Baked Italian Grinder Sandwiches feature crusty hoagie rolls loaded with ham, salami, pepperoni, and melted mozzarella, topped with a zesty oregano-butter glaze. Perfect for easy dinners or game day snacks.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es
Total Time 30 minutes
Servings: 4 sandwiches
Course: Dinner, Lunch
Cuisine: American, Italian
Calories: 645

Ingredients
  

Sandwich Components
  • 4 Hoagie Rolls crusty, approx 6-inch
  • 8 oz Sliced Ham thinly sliced and folded
  • 6 oz Salami thinly sliced
  • 4 oz Pepperoni sliced
  • 8 oz Mozzarella Cheese sliced or shredded
Herb Butter Glaze
  • 4 tbsp Butter unsalted, melted
  • 1 tsp Dried Oregano
  • 1/2 tsp Red Pepper Flakes

Equipment

  • 1 Baking Sheet Lined with parchment paper
  • 1 Pastry Brush

Method
 

Preparation
  1.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  2. Slice the hoagie rolls horizontally and place the bottom halves on the prepared baking sheet.
Assembly
  1. Layer the folded ham, salami, and pepperoni evenly across the bottom halves of the rolls.
  2. Top the meat with a thick layer of mozzarella cheese.
  3. Bake open-faced for 5-8 minutes until the cheese is melted and bubbling.
Finishing
  1. Place the top halves of the rolls on the sandwiches. Brush the tops with the melted butter, oregano, and red pepper flake mixture.
  2. Bake for an additional 4-5 minutes until the bread is golden brown and crispy.

Notes

Use room temperature deli meats for a faster, more even melt.
Substitute provolone for a sharper cheese flavor.
